Controlled fracture techniques were successfully applied to the study of adhesion. A new parameter, interfacial work of fracture (Wi), was defined and measured for porcelain-gold specimens and for enamel-composite specimens. Wi measurements coupled with factographs indicated that a "highly etched" enamel surface may not give the strongest bond.
